Runbook fragment — Brinefall account recovery, firmware update channel. If a device on the Larkspur channel loses its enrollment after an interrupted update, re-provision through the quarantine endpoint, verify the signed manifest twice, and confirm the rollback slot is intact before promoting. Reviewers: check that the retry guard is unchanged. The quarantine console accepts the recovery passphrase printed directly below this line.

unlock words, bahop-fawef: novmir-druwyn-soriel-rusdor-kasion

Handover: Exportron retry queue

Hi Mira — handing over the failed-export retries. Exports that hit a timeout land in the retry queue and get three attempts with backoff; after that they're parked and need a manual requeue from the admin panel. Watch for customers reporting duplicates — that usually means a double requeue. The current retry settings are as follows.

settings of bajog-fawig:
oliael:
  log_level: warn
  metrics_host: metrics.oliael.zemvarsys.internal
  pin: 0267
  pool_size: 32

Title: Clock skew between Harrowfell build agents causes flaky cache invalidation

New folks: agents harrow-03 and harrow-07 drift up to 40 seconds apart because their NTP sync points at a decommissioned host. Artifacts built on harrow-07 sometimes appear "older" than their sources, so the Bramblegate cache rebuilds them needlessly. Workaround until infra repoints NTP: pin release builds to harrow-03. Full repro steps are in the attached log bundle, and the trace token for the failing run sits just below.

pipeline stamp: htk31_f769b577b3028a4e9958e5bb8d1259a

**Runbook: Audit-log viewer — Ferrowatch**

If folks report the Ferrowatch audit-log viewer showing stale entries, it's almost always the indexer lagging, not data loss. Check the indexer lag metric first — under 5 minutes is fine, just wait it out. Over 15 minutes, restart the indexer pod on the Duskvale cluster; it catches up fast. Don't touch the retention job while the indexer is behind, that's how we got the gap last quarter. Step-by-step restart instructions and the escalation rota are on the page below.

runbook for yafof-kahif: https://jira.qorvelsys.internal/browse/display/pages/browse/0c52